行业动态

oracle数据恢复到一天之前

作者:小编 日期:2024-04-02 浏览:

如何将Oracle数据库恢复到一天之前

在日常操作中,有时候我们会不小心删除了重要的数据,或者数据库发生了意外故障,需要将数据库恢复到一天之前的状态。下面将介绍如何使用Oracle数据库进行数据恢复。

备份数据库

在进行数据恢复之前,首先需要确保数据库有定期备份。如果数据库没有备份,那么将无法恢复到一天之前的状态。可以使用Oracle提供的备份工具或者第三方备份软件来创建数据库备份。

使用Flashback技术

Oracle数据库提供了Flashback技术,可以方便地将数据库恢复到过去的某个时间点。可以使用以下SQL语句将数据库恢复到一天之前的状态:。

FLASHBACK DATABASE TO TIMESTAMP (SYSDATE-1);。

恢复数据文件

如果数据库发生了数据文件丢失或损坏的情况,可以使用RMA工具来恢复数据文件。可以使用以下命令来恢复数据文件:。

RMA> RESTORE DATAFILE '';。

验证恢复

在完成数据恢复之后,需要对数据库进行验证,确保恢复成功。可以使用以下SQL语句来检查数据库是否已经恢复到一天之前的状态:。

SELECT FROM able_ame AS OF TIMESTAMP (SYSDATE-1);。

通过备份数据库、使用Flashback技术、恢复数据文件和验证恢复等步骤,可以将Oracle数据库成功恢复到一天之前的状态。在日常操作中,建议定期备份数据库,以防止意外情况的发生。


  电话咨询